Metboy's Cave

Covesea Quarry, Lossiemouth, Moray (Elginshire).

NGR:NJ 17146 70379
WGS84:57.71552, -3.39238
Length:Not recorded
Vert. Range:Not recorded
Altitude:17 m
Geology:Hopeman Sandstone Formation
Tags:Cave, SeaCave, ManMade
Registry:main

A relatively small cave has had minor quarrying on inside roof and is another very well hidden entrance on raised beach. Entrance roof displays in-situ Permian reptilian footprint trails. I first reported these trails early 1990s, I'm a retired 'metboy'...meteorologist, Elgin Museum joke...' [Dave Longstaff]

Alternative Names: None recorded.

Notes: Access: down from the path at about NJ 16952 70338 through disused Covesea Quarry workings and then a steep rock debris slope. Slightly easier at the E end. Bottom half of tide.
